Deputy Richard Boyd Barrett asked the Minister for Education the accommodation plan for a school (details supplied) for the 2024-2025 school year; when An Bord Pleanála will make a final decision on the permanent school building in Blackrock; the annual rental cost for the school building in the present location; and if she will make a statement on the matter. [12965/23]

View answer

Written answers

The permanent building project for the school referred to by the Deputy is being delivered under my Department's Design and Build programme which uses a professional external Project Manager to progress the project through the relevant stages of architectural planning, tender and construction.

The project when complete will provide a new 1,000 pupil post-primary school building and accommodation, including 4 classrooms, for children with special educational needs on the permanent site for the school.

An application for Planning Permission for the school was submitted to the Local Authority in June 2021. The initial grant of planning was received from the Local Authority in May 2022 but was subsequently the subject of third party appeal to An Bord Pleanála. The decision on the appeal was due from An Bord Pleanála in November 2022, this was subsequently delayed to January 2023 and has since been further delayed with no new decision date provided.

My Department will not be releasing the rental costs associated for this schools accommodation as they are commercially sensitive.

My Department will continue to address the interim accommodation requirements for the school and will continue to keep the school, through its Patron Body updated in relation to same.
